Description
Delving into the fascinating world of fermentation, Louis Pasteur takes readers on an enlightening journey through the science behind one of humanity's oldest craft - brewing. With a warm and engaging approach, he breaks down complex concepts, making them accessible and intriguing.
From the interesting chemistry of yeast to the fermentation processes that elevate simple ingredients into delicious beverages, Pasteur’s insights are not only informative but also rich with historical context. This work sparks curiosity about the small organisms that play a huge role in our food and drink, celebrating the blend of science and everyday life.
